
Retronauts Micro Samples the Catchiest Shop Themes
This week, USgamer's classic gaming podcast presents a collection of songs to get you in the spending mood.
If you've ever done your grocery shopping accompanied by a seemingly endless loop of Carly Rae Jepsen's "Call Me Maybe," you'd know just how vital music is to the shopping experience.
That's why I've decided to return to the mixtape well for the episode of Retronauts Micro. Not too long ago, I used this format to explore the best RPG town themes, and this week, we're getting a little more granular in a way Retronauts often does. Now, most games don't bother to include a separate song to listen to while you're spending fictional currency, but the ones that do tend to put their full force behind making these compositions as catchy and peppy as humanly possible. In this episode, I've included what I feel are definitely the most notable songs, but let me know in the comments if I've missed any of your personal favorites!
